About us:
Damen Song Cam Shipyard Co., Ltd (DSCS) is a joint venture between Damen Workboats in the Netherlands (70%) and Song Cam Shipyard (30%), member of SBIC and based in Haiphong, Vietnam. At a 42 hectares site just outside Haiphong, Damen Song Cam is a strategic and preferred production location within the Damen Workboats to produce tug- and workboats up to 60 meters. At the moment the shipyard is a dedicated outfitting shipyard: up to 45 hulls are procured from our partner shipyards. DSCS is performing outfitting, commissioning and delivery to clients worldwide. The role:
The QC Supervisor (Painting part) is responsible for monitoring and checking the blasting and painting activities (prior/after) to ensure that final result complies with quality requirements
Key accountabilities:
- Pre-inspection:
- Review the construction method statements and make comments per ITPs, procedures & painting specification
- Advise to develop an Inspection Test Plan (ITP) painting part and necessary QC procedures when required
- Material inspection:
- Inspect paint materials to ensure that they are stored in good condition.
- Salt test:
- Chloride Test to be carried out as per Standard (When required).
- Pre-surface Preparation inspection:
- Verify drawings and identify all spaces and specified surface preparation method for each area
- Review the painting system and paint data sheet
- Check the ambient conditions before and during blasting & painting processes
- Ensure that the surface is free of irregularities (weld spatter, slag burrs, sharp edges, pits, laminations, or other objectionable irregularities)
- Ensure surface is free of contaminants (oil, grease, salts)
- Ensure that abrasives meet specification requirements and are within contamination limits
- Ensure the air compressor is free of moisture and oil contamination
- Post-surface Preparation inspection:
- Ensure the surface preparation method meets specifications requirements
- Ensure the surface (anchor) profile meets specifications requirements
- Ensure the surface is free of contaminants and meets cleanliness specifications requirements
- Pre-coating Application inspection:
- Check the paint drum (manufacture, paint name, batch number, batch certificate, expiry date etc.
- Monitor and ensure over coating intervals between each coat of paint
- Ensure environmental conditions (ambient and surface temperatures, humidity, and dew point) meet specifications requirements
- Ensure mixing and thinning meet manufacturer’s requirements
- Check application equipment (pump size, nozzle size, pressure gauge, paint hose)
- During Coating Application inspection:
- Ensure application methods meet manufacturer’s requirements
- Check ambient temperature and humidity, ventilation during drying/curing period
- Check wet film thickness and paint layer defects during paint application
- Post coating Application inspection:
- Ensure the dry film thickness meets specification requirements
- Inspect dry film for holiday (pinhole, cracking and sagging, blistering defects, continuity
- Ensure that defective, damaged, and deficient areas are repaired to meet specification requirements
- Check final paint/coating color, appearances, and shade uniformity.
